This week's episode is the first of a monthly new teacher voice episode. This involves a new teacher coming on to the podcast for a coaching conversation about a particular issue they are facing in their careers. 

Rosa Albashir is the guest on this episode. She asks the question: How can I develop confidence in a new school setting? 

In exploring this topic, we discuss how: new teachers can be honest and vulnerable with their mentors;  how to orchestrate assimilating themselves in new school contexts; how to build positive relationships with other staff members; and how to mange feelings of self-doubt when joining a new school.
